Output c95f9952da0e3a8d98497944c2b5e698e1a2988187a7a90079174d8705b137b6:3

value
7636629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 850b761a04283ebaabc05dedab336cad2fb896ae OP_EQUAL
address
3DpVXQRba4L4fPijtsJetoik4zMUqvttHX
transaction
c95f9952da0e3a8d98497944c2b5e698e1a2988187a7a90079174d8705b137b6
spent
true